Output db129c3d74caaa3109aaf2803148ff9ac111c80e34c3ef79c7bfd6d9acb246e4:58

value
623983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109a4e20a75256d1a8f10b2e032c0ecdd5c8fb67 OP_EQUAL
address
33CoavcyZkoSiGLNdaQFVNiaGXGctQRzm7
transaction
db129c3d74caaa3109aaf2803148ff9ac111c80e34c3ef79c7bfd6d9acb246e4
spent
true